Gianluigi Donnarumma says Italy are ‘where we deserve to be’ as the reigning European Champions after securing their ticket to EURO 2024.

The Azzurri got the point they needed against Ukraine this evening in Leverkusen to secure qualification, thanks to a superior head-to-head record.

It was a tough slog on neutral turf in Leverkusen, especially in stoppages when Bryan Cristante appeared to trip Mykhaylo Mudryk, but the referee and VAR waved play on.

“We are very happy, we are where we deserve to be, albeit with all the difficulties we had. Thanks also to the new coach and staff, we are back,” Donnarumma told RAI Sport.

“It’s only right that we are there, because we are the trophy holders, and we want to win it again.”

Italy won EURO 2020, even though it was played in the summer of 2021 due to the pandemic, under previous coach Roberto Mancini, who resigned to take over the Saudi Arabia role in August.

“There was so much pride, we thank all these fans, they gave us an incredible hand to defend in the final minutes, they can’t know the help they gave us. Now we celebrate, we are there too.”

The draw for the group phase will be held on December 2 and this result means Italy will be in Pot 4.
